Subject: Tide widget cut-over complete

Team — the Moorcroft tide-table widget now reads from the new Seabright prediction service instead of the legacy Gullwing feed. Cached tables carry over unchanged; refresh cadence is unchanged at fifteen minutes. Future maintainers: the old feed is deprecated and will be removed next quarter, so don't re-point anything at it. The widget's current runtime configuration is as follows.

config for haweg-bagag:
[kasath]
host = kasath.qirvancorp.internal
user = kasath_svc
database = kasath_prod

Quartzbin partitions the `events` table by calendar month. New partitions auto-create on the 25th; do not create them manually. Plugins must route reads through the partition router — direct table access breaks when old months are detached. Detached partitions archive to Coldvault after 90 days. To query the partition router from your plugin, authenticate with the key below.

gateway credential: kto23_LX9A4ys6i4nzHtpOLNLodKK

Hi, and welcome to the rotation! You'll be covering Tilecrest, our map-tile prefetcher that warms the cache ahead of popular viewport paths. It's mostly quiet, but when the prediction queue backs up you'll get paged, and the fix is usually draining stale jobs and restarting the fetch workers. Don't restart the scheduler unless latency stays high for 15+ minutes. Everything else, including escalation steps, lives on our on-call page.

operations page: https://confluence.zemvarlabs.internal/pages/pages/display/1e40d760

**CI note: timezone weirdness in report exports**

Heads up, support folks — if a customer says their Ledgerpine export shows times shifted by a few hours, it's probably the CI image. The export workers got rebuilt last week and the base image defaults to UTC, while older workers used the account's locale. Fix is rolling out; meanwhile tell customers the data itself is fine, just the display offset. Affected exports carry the build token shown below.

build token for bajof-tahop: htk4_a981